Understanding the National Guard Retirement System
The National Guard retirement system is a blended system that combines traditional pension benefits with a 401(k)-style savings plan called the Thrift Savings Plan (TSP). This system provides flexibility and allows you to tailor your retirement plan to your individual needs.

Planning for a Secure Retirement
Maximizing Your Contributions: The TSP allows you to contribute up to $19,500 per year, with additional catch-up contributions available for members over age 50. By maximizing your contributions, you can significantly increase your retirement savings.
Investing Wisely: The TSP offers a variety of investment funds to choose from, including stocks, bonds, and target-date funds. Consider your risk tolerance and investment goals when making your selections.
